Transaction 3480950e5281bde3813bdbf9f8dfb5a11bbe9ce2f7834760a1479b3c0bb9220a

1 Input
2 Outputs
  • 3480950e5281bde3813bdbf9f8dfb5a11bbe9ce2f7834760a1479b3c0bb9220a:0
  • value  20394428
    address  1EbQjC3QPWkSixzJs2HvZdcXS5tyVdu3uj
  • 3480950e5281bde3813bdbf9f8dfb5a11bbe9ce2f7834760a1479b3c0bb9220a:1
  • value  4757837557
    address  37tovP3Q7miN75P4tz4iYx9B9FyaQX2kdB